Pros

Better than unemployment, possibly a good starter company for an agent if they have never worked in call center environment with policies and processes already established.

Cons

Payroll, no system in place for recording actual time worked. Depends on a manager approving and submitting your hours hoping it actually happens and your paid on the actual paydate and correctly for the hours you worked. My experience was I was input into the system incorrectly, salary vs hourly, so when it came to my last pay check it was delayed for 5 days causing me to lose my apartment. The entire time I worked there I had no idea who was aactually submitting my time for my pay and no one in my department s management, HR, or project managers could tell me either. Of course it took me over two weeks to find someone that could tell me my employee ID number needed for a system needed to do my job correctly so I was not surprised by No one knowing who was handling my payroll. I reported to my manager on the payday following Christmas that I didn't receive my holiday pay for working Christmas day, I'm waiting for that check to possibly be sent out this week maybe. A coworker who has also resigned (due to lack of training, established processes, and leadership in the role) is still waiting for the first paycheck that should have been received almost three weeks ago along with last paycheck from last Friday. HR informed that the check was cut from payroll for the 78 hours worked before quitting and could be picked up next day, its still not been received by my former coworker or the AZ office and guess what... no one knows anything to be able to explain the issue for the delay. The people were wonderful I loved working with them. I can't blame them for the lack of processes, knowledge, or training when the senior manager over the project had only 3 weeks seniority over me and was still teaching himself his own job.
